Who is God

Someone posed the question to me, who is God? As if I could possibly know the unknowable—no one knows who or what God is. If you believe that God fits nicely boxed into any one definition that mankind has assigned, then I dare say you need to check your hubris and open your mind. 

For me, I prefer using the term Source or Source Energy, Spirit, Divine Consciousness, Divine Light—being neither male nor female, but also both, because there is nothing that God is not. Like Yin-Yang, Life is balance.

Who is God?  

God is everything we don’t understand and all the things we do.
God is the most delicate wildflower unseen and the honey bee who pollinates it.
God is a river rock at the bottom of a woodland stream, polished smooth by eons of cascading mountain water. 
God is the red tail hawk soaring in a clear blue sky and the cottontail bunny who burrows in the green grass below. 
God is the wind and the rain, the sunshine and the rainbow. 
God is the unfathomable eternal universe, and the scientific mathematical equations of quantum physics trying to prove its existence. 
God is the crying newborn baby and a grandmother’s last breath. 
God is Kundalini rising, seven chakras and the third eye.  
God is the sinner and the saint. 
God is Unconditional Love and abiding faith. 
God is You.
God is Me.
